We have four different environments – dev VMs, dev, QA and prod. All environments have the following setting for the “website” site:

<site name="website" virtualFolder="/" physicalFolder="/" 
rootPath="/sitecore/content" startItem="/home" database="master" 
domain="extranet" allowDebug="true" cacheHtml="false" 
htmlCacheSize="10MB" registryCacheSize="0" viewStateCacheSize="0" 
xslCacheSize="5MB" filteredItemsCacheSize="2MB" enablePreview="true" 
enableWebEdit="true" enableDebugger="true" 
disableClientData="false" loginPage="/" hostName="www.site.com" 
enableFallback="true" enforceVersionPresence="true"/>.

So on VM and prod, http://www.site.com/en/home/press and http://www.site.com/en/press work.

But on dev and QA, http://www.site.com/en/home/press works but http://www.site.com/en/press doesn’t work. (Works with startItem but gets a 404 without it).

This is happening with ISAPI enabled and disabled both (no exceptions).

I am not sure what is going on here or where else to look except to make sure that my start item is in good shape which it seems to be.

What can I do to resolve this? If you need more information please let me know.

    Try looking at the:

    “linkManager” tag in the web.config, there is a property called:

    languageEmbedding: asNeeded | always | never

    which could be set differently on those solutiuons.
